Utility model content
The utility model provides a kind of electromagnet panel holder, its objective is and solve the shortcoming that prior art exists, while making processing work the distortion of workpiece little, machining accuracy is high.
The utility model solves the technical scheme that its technical problem adopts:
Electromagnet panel holder, is characterized in that: comprise the cylinder axis with axially extending bore of an iron material matter, the outer wall of axle is arranged with coil, and coil is connected with dc source; An end face of axle is absorption panel, on absorption panel, offers cross recess; Described axle is arranged on lathe, and absorption of workpieces, on absorption panel, is also provided with back-up block on lathe, and back-up block contact is on the lower surface of workpiece.
Usefulness of the present utility model is:
Magnetic suction jig of the present utility model can better guarantee the precision of product.Magnetic suction jig is to hold product by electromagnetic force, is that end face is stressed, then supports at the cylindrical of workpiece, in process, can not cause because of clamping the stress deformation of excircle of workpiece and endoporus.
Magnetic suction jig has avoided common frock to change frequently the trouble of fixture.This magnetic-adsorption frock, in process, is not subject to External Force Acting substantially, so wearing and tearing are very little, almost can ignore, so once mounting, can guarantee in the life-span of long-time fixture, with plain clamp comparison, can realize the effect of putting things right once and for all.
Magnetic suction jig has been avoided the trueness error of bringing because of frock clamp wearing and tearing.This frock is owing to being to replace clamping by magnetic-adsorption, thus in actual process, in the time of clamping materials and parts the actual friction of workpiece and fixture very little, substantially can ignore, therefore also avoided the trueness error of bringing because of frock clamp wearing and tearing.
The specific embodiment
As shown in Figure 1 and Figure 2:
The utility model is mounted in the fixture on lathe, and lathe can be lathe, internal grinder etc.
The utility model comprises a castiron cylinder axis with axially extending bore 20 2 for the sufficient length of design as required, the outer wall of axle 2 is arranged with the enamel wire coil 1 of the sufficient length of design as required, coil 1 is connected with dc source 10, circuit comprises ammeter 3, swept resistance 5, switch 9, the dc source 10 of series connection, is also parallel with two voltmeters 6,7 on circuit.
An end face of axle 2 is absorption panel 21, on absorption panel 21, offers cross recess 22; Described axle 2 is arranged on lathe, then allows coil 1 lead to upper direct current, has so just formed a closed magnetic flux, and the flow direction of electric current has determined the south poles of magnetic force, and the size of electric current is relevant with the adsorption strength of magnetic force.Because closed magnetic flux is not possess adsorption capacity, therefore end face is also adsorbed to panel 21 shapes designs a cross recess 22, to form magnetic leakage, so both meets the requirement of absorption, has also met the locating surface requirement as workpiece 8.
Columniform workpiece 8 is adsorbed on absorption panel 21, and back-up block 4 is also installed on lathe, and back-up block 4 contacts are at the lower surface of workpiece 8.
During the actual use of the utility model:
First alternating voltage is converted to DC voltage, and controls voltage can not ether large or too little (concrete debugging determine according to actual conditions), be connected to positive and negative polarities formation dc source 10 stand-by;
Process the axle 2 of the cast iron of Fig. 1, Fig. 2 structure, and guarantee to be installed in lathe, but directly do not install, standby;
By the enamel-covered wire in Fig. 11, with the form of pitch of the laps on axle 2 (during coiling, the number of turn is abundant, and it is enough even that coiling is wanted) uniformly, the position that install at axle 2 two in addition will reserve next, so that Installation and adjustment below;
Switch 9 is in to open mode, standby;
Swept resistance 5 is in maximum state, standby;
Adopt whether safe condition of voltage that voltmeter 6 detects dc sources 10, in order to avoid burn out during follow-up unlatching, cause security incident;
According to Fig. 1, the equipment such as all circuits and voltmeter 6,7, ammeter 3, swept resistance 5 are connected to (noting wherein after switch 9 tippings, must disconnecting), and checked errorless;
The combination of axle 2 and the enamel-covered wire 1 that winds is installed on lathe, and fixes;
Flatness and the perpendicularity of the end face of the conduct absorption panel 21 of axis calibration 2, in order to avoid surpass into trueness error;
Adjustment is arranged on the back-up block 4 on lathe, guarantees that the axis of workpiece 8 and the axis of axle 2 are on same center line, and guarantees that the end face of workpiece 8 can well adsorb on the end face of the conduct absorption panel 21 that leans against axle 2;
Switch on power, check whether ammeter 3, voltmeter 6,7 are in normal frock state, and adjust swept resistance 5 adjusting resistances, to guarantee that the magnetic force that axle 2 produces enough holds workpiece 8 above;
The suction that frock after energising can produce by electromagnetism has fixed workpiece 8, and workpiece 8 leans on is the suction of absorption panel 21, and the support of back-up block 4 locates, so the endoporus 80 processing, precision is high, be out of shape little, good stability.
After machining, because workpiece 8 bands are magnetic, need demagnetization to process (demagnetization method is a lot, has just no longer introduced) here;
After demagnetization, can, according to normal operating sequence at ordinary times, turn off lathe, the equipment such as power supply.
